在用SQL Server数据库开发应用程序时,连接数据库是一项必不可少的工作,通常情况下连接字符串connectionStrings连接SQL Server数据库有两种方式如下:
一种是用户名+password,如:string= "server=localhost;database=pubs;user id=sa;password=11";
另一种是使用windows验证,它已经集成了windows的安全验证方式,如sspi,所以此时你没必要输入密码,也可以访问数据库,也就是你有进入windows的权限,也就有了访问它的权限。
关于sql连接语句中的Integrated Security=SSPI。
设置Integrated Security为True 的时候,连接语句前面的 UserID, PW 是不起作用的,即采用windows身份验证模式。
只有设置为False或省略该项的时候,才按照 UserID, PW来连接。
Integrated Security可以设置为: True, false, yes, no ,这四个的意思很明白了,还可以设置为:sspi ,相当于True,建议用这个代替True。
关于使用connectionStrings连接字符串的知识就介绍到这里了,希望本次的介绍能够带给您一些收获!
【编辑推荐】